Long ago, the Tacana people lived peacefully in the Amazon rainforest. But food was becoming scarce. They relied heavily on hunting, and one of the most coveted animals was jochi pintao, a spotted peccary known for its speed and elusiveness. The hunters set out to catch jochi pintao, following its tracks deep into the forest. But the clever animal always managed to escape.
